Though largely desert, Turkmenistan is extremely rich in oil and gas and figures prominently in the growing importance of resource politics in the Caspian region. This excellent new book provides a concise overview of the country, discussing its history, politics, culture, foreign policy and economy.
1. Introduction 2. Turkmen Culture and Social Structure in the Late Nineteenth and Early Twentieth Century 3. The History of Turkmenistan from 1885 to 1991 4. Turkmenbashy and Authoritarian Rule 5. Reaching Out: Turkmenistan and the International Arena 6. From Cotton to Gas: Turkmenistan's Economy and Environment 7. Conclusion
